I hereby declare version 0.99b of the Overloaded Game Foundation 'final'. Next version will be the 1.00 beta, wich is going to be released somewhere in September.
All 0.98 users are encouraged to download the new 0.99 version from the download page at .
The new version offers, amongst other things and fixes:
- JPeg file support (& automatic file type detection)
- Landscape support
- Battery monitor ('ingame', no more ugly popups)
- Surface clipping
- Window scaling in 'emulated' mode
The 0.99 Overloaded Game Foundation is now a highly stable and sophisticated tool for creating games for PocketPC's.
The 0.99 version is not just a code update, but also a 'program update': We have changed the rules to allow for more flexibility when it comes to a financial reward.

Basic content-less game (pacman, meltdown,...) - up to $500
Basic content-driven game (Pang!, Magnets,...) - up to $1000
Complex content-driven game (The Nutcracker,...) - up to $2500
Extra points for 'connected' features:
* User level submission
* Convincing and challenging hiscore system
* Original 'connected' ideas are a HUGE plus!
Extra points for polished products:
* Sound effects, music, professional gfx
Extra points for exclusivity:
* Unpublished product
* Unported product (when porting from GB / PC / PS2)
Extra points for originality:
* Brilliant game ideas
* Brilliant PocketPC / Smartphone port of existing game idea
* Brilliant use of connected features
As you can see, there's a lot of emphasis on 'connected' features.
The 1.00 version will also support Smartphones.
Other plans for the 1.00 version:
- 3D graphics
- Multiplayer functionality
- Stable interface
